Asbestos roof removal and disposal methods and procedures are critical not only for compliance with regulations but additionally for making certain the protection of people and the surroundings. Asbestos, as soon as favored for its insulation and fireplace resistance properties, has since been recognized as a hazardous material linked to extreme health issues. The removal course of is complicated and requires careful planning, adherence to regulations, and professional expertise.

Before initiating the removal course of, it's important to conduct a radical inspection of the roof. This involves identifying any asbestos-containing materials, quantifying the amount current, and assessing the situation of the materials. If the asbestos is intact and undisturbed, it may be safer to go away it alone. However, if renovation or demolition is deliberate, or if the asbestos is damaged, removal turns into essential.

Having identified the presence of asbestos, the following step includes notifying local health and security authorities. Many jurisdictions require notification before starting any asbestos removal project. This is crucial not just for compliance but in addition for safeguarding public health. The notification can embody details on the placement, the type and quantity of asbestos, and the planned strategies for removal and disposal.


Protective measures must be taken for staff concerned in the removal process. This includes wearing appropriate personal protecting tools (PPE) corresponding to respirators, disposable coveralls, and gloves. The space should be secured to limit entry to unauthorized people and to scale back the danger of asbestos fiber release into the air.

Before the physical removal of the asbestos materials, establishing a containment area is significant. This sometimes includes sealing the work space with heavy-duty plastic sheeting to create a managed surroundings. Negative air stress techniques may be employed to guarantee that any airborne fibers stay contained throughout the work space. This step is important in stopping contaminants from escaping into surrounding areas.

When it comes to the actual removal course of, you will need to comply with best practices to minimize the discharge of asbestos fibers. Methods embody wetting the asbestos material with water earlier than removal to limit dust formation. Hand instruments ought to be used as an alternative of power instruments to keep away from unnecessary disturbance. Each piece of asbestos material must be fastidiously eliminated and handled to avoid breaking it into smaller, extra hazardous pieces.


Post-removal, the asbestos must be positioned in correctly labeled, sealed containers to prevent any additional launch of fibers. These containers have to be transported to a licensed disposal facility that is geared up to handle asbestos. Regulations often dictate particular disposal methods, together with double-wrapping the materials and clearly labeling them as hazardous waste. Compliance with these regulations is crucial to avoid authorized repercussions and to protect public health.


In certain eventualities, encapsulation can be thought of as an alternative alternative to full removal. This includes sealing asbestos materials to prevent fibers from changing into airborne. However, encapsulation is not at all times suitable, particularly if the asbestos is in deteriorating situation or if future renovations are deliberate. This technique requires ongoing monitoring and upkeep to make sure its effectiveness.


After the removal and disposal processes are complete, air monitoring may be conducted to ensure no asbestos fibers remain within the vicinity. This entails amassing air samples to research the concentration of airborne asbestos. Achieving acceptable ranges is essential for declaring the world safe for reintegration into common use.

Throughout the complete process, a detailed documentation of all actions is required. This contains regulations followed, amounts and forms of asbestos eliminated, disposal methods employed, and air monitoring results. Well-maintained information protect both the contractor and property proprietor and might function verification of compliance with environmental regulations.


Public awareness relating to the hazards of asbestos has led to stricter regulations, bettering safety in industries which will encounter the fabric (Sydney Residential Asbestos Roof Removal). Engaging licensed professionals with experience in asbestos abatement ensures that removal and disposal procedures adhere to the best requirements. Choosing qualified individuals minimizes dangers and promotes a safer surroundings for all.
